Julia Morris has opened up about what it was like to work with Robert Irwin on I’m a Celebrity.. Get Me Out Of Here! and why she thinks he deserves the coveted Gold Logie award.
In an interview with Stellar’s Something To Talk About podcast, the comedian gushed that Robert is the most “perfect” person.
“The only way I can describe him, and I know people don’t like the word, and he won’t like the word ‘perfect’, but he’s like a perfectly formed human,” she said.
“[Robert] is the person I’d like to become when I grow up.”
She previously commended the 22-year-old for his dedication, saying that “it was so extraordinary” to see how hard he was working to balance filming multiple TV shows.
“He went from the ballroom floor to the airport to do Good Morning America,” she told Yahoo Lifestyle.
“Then he flew to Johannesburg, with the many different stopovers, to us in Kruger and started work the next day. I think he is an extraordinary human being.”
The duo have spent a lot of time together while filming the show in South Africa over the past few years, and now they have both been nominated for the iconic Gold Logie Award for the Most Popular Personality in Australian Television.
The 22-year-old is also hosting the show and going up against other Aussie TV personalities including A Current Affair presenter Allison Langdon, MasterChef judge Poh Ling Yeow, the ABC’s Lisa Millar, Sam Pang, and Channel 9 sport presenter Todd Woodbridge.
This is Julia’s fifth Gold Logie nomination over her 41-year career, and she said that while she would appreciate the recognition she thinks her former co-star was more deserving of the award.
“I think the best idea is to give [the Logie] to someone else,” she said.
“And when I say someone else, obviously, I mean Robert”.
“I speak often about Robert being the future of television,” she continued.
“No one needs to be worried about the future if we’ve got more young people like Robert coming through. I think we’re gonna be fine.”
